Abstract

The utility model discloses a fence wire connector, which comprises a box body and a cover body, wherein a plurality of wire connecting grooves used for connecting electric cores are arranged in the box body, a partition plate is arranged between every two adjacent wire connecting grooves, and a clamping groove is formed in the edge of the upper part of the partition plate; one side of the cover body is provided with a pin shaft, and the other end of the cover body is provided with a clamping jaw; the box body is provided with a sliding hole, and two ends of the pin shaft are inserted into the sliding hole; when the cover body is moved to enable the pin shaft to move left and right in the sliding hole, the clamping claws are clamped with or separated from the clamping grooves. The fence wire connector is combined with a fence type design, so that the volume of various matched equipment can be reduced, the weight can be reduced, and the fence wire connector is convenient to use due to the adoption of an integrated sliding flip type design.

Fence wire connector
Technical Field
The utility model relates to the technical field of wiring terminals, in particular to a fence wire connector.
Background
In the traditional circuit board large current transmission, for safety and no electromagnetic interference influences components on a board, the circuit board large current connector can be very thick and heavy, and the size and the weight of equipment are limited. At present, the volume is not compressed to a very small value to obtain a large-current wire connector for a circuit board at home and abroad, in addition, a simple box body and a cover body are adopted in a conventional wire connector, the compression resistance is not reliable when the wire connector is used for current connection, the cost of a complex wire connector is high, and the maintenance difficulty is high, so that a novel fence type wire connector needs to be designed.
SUMMERY OF THE UTILITY MODEL
The utility model provides a fence wire connector which is improved aiming at the defects of the current wire connector at present, fully insulated while having safe insulation, and ensures that various matching devices have reduced volume and weight.
In order to achieve the purpose, the scheme of the utility model is as follows:
a fence wire connector comprises a box body and a cover body, wherein a plurality of wire connecting grooves used for connecting electric cores are arranged in the box body, a partition plate is arranged between every two adjacent wire connecting grooves, and a clamping groove is formed in the edge of the upper portion of the partition plate; one side of the cover body is provided with a pin shaft, and the other end of the cover body is provided with a clamping jaw; the box body is provided with a sliding hole, and two ends of the pin shaft are inserted into the sliding hole; when the cover body is moved to enable the pin shaft to move towards the left side of the sliding hole, the clamping claw is clamped with the clamping groove; the cover body is moved to enable the pin to axially slide the hole (the claw is separated from the clamping groove when the right side moves.
In the utility model, a notch is formed in the other side, opposite to the clamping groove, of the partition plate, and the middle part of the pin shaft is positioned in the notch.
In the utility model, the wiring groove is provided with cell holes at two sides and a locking groove in the middle.
In the utility model, when the cover body is covered, the bottom of the cover body is attached to the partition plate.

As shown in fig. 1-4, the present invention provides a fence wire connector, which comprises a box body 1 and a cover body 2 matched with the box body; the bottom of the box body 1 is provided with four wiring grooves 13, the left side and the right side of the box body 1 are provided with side plates 11, partition plates 12 are arranged between the adjacent wiring grooves and the inner sides of the two side plates 11, the height of each partition plate 12 is slightly lower than that of each side plate 11, the cover body 2 is flush with the height of each side plate 11 when being covered, and the lower part of the cover body 2 is in contact with the partition plates 12 to improve the supporting strength; one end of the upper part of the partition plate 12 is provided with a notch 1201, the other end is provided with a clamping groove 1202, and the clamping groove 1202 is in an inverted 5 shape; the upper edges of the two side plates 11 are provided with slide holes 1101 corresponding to the positions of the notches 1201, and the slide holes 1101 are 7-shaped or I-shaped. Correspondingly, one side part of the cover body 2 is provided with a pin shaft 21, the other opposite side part is provided with a clamping jaw 22 matched with the clamping groove 1202, and the depth of the clamping jaw 22 is consistent with the length of the sliding hole 1101; two ends of the pin 21 are respectively inserted into the left and right slide holes 1101, and the middle part is positioned in the gap 1201. As shown in fig. 3, when the cover 2 is closed, the pin 21 slides to the left of the sliding hole 1101, and the claw 22 synchronously enters the slot 1202; when the cover 2 is opened, the pin 21 slides to the right side of the sliding hole 1101, the claw 22 synchronously leaves the slot 1202, and at this time, the cover 2 is rotated upward.
In the utility model, as shown in fig. 4, the wiring groove 13 is a groove structure, and includes a locking groove 1302 located in the middle and cell holes 1301 located on both sides and having a bottom penetrating therethrough, when in use, a cell respectively penetrates into the left and right cell holes 1301 from below and extends pins into the locking groove 1302, the pins are pressed by a pin gasket, then a locking bolt is installed into the locking groove 1302, and then the cell is welded to the cell hole 1301.
